Crypto Miner Canaan Shares Sink 7% Despite Strong Q4

Crypto miner and manufacturer Canaan fell 6.9% on the Nasdaq on Tuesday despite reporting a 121.1% year-on-year increase in revenue to $196.3 million in the fourth quarter, driven by an increase in hardware sales and stronger mining performance. Canaan reported that its Bitcoin (BTC) mining revenue rose 98.5% year-on-year to $30.4 million, helping boost its … Read more

UK Central Bank to Launch Onchain Settlement Infrastructure Pilot

The Bank of England has launched a new industry experimentation initiative to explore how tokenized assets could be settled using synchronized, atomic settlement in British pounds sterling as part of efforts to modernize the UK’s real-time gross settlement (RTGS) infrastructure. The Synchronisation Lab initiative will allow 18 selected companies to test delivery-versus-payment and payment-versus-payment settlement between the … Read more

The United Kingdom’s financial watchdog has launched court action against cryptocurrency exchange HTX, alleging it illegally promoted crypto asset services to British consumers in breach of financial advertising rules. The UK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) said it began proceedings against HTX and several related persons in the Chancery Division of the High Court in October … Read more

Backpack, a crypto exchange founded by former employees of FTX, says it will launch a 1-billion-supply token in the future, with its distribution schedule tied to its goal of going public in the US. Backpack posted to X on Monday that its token launch will begin with 25% of the intended supply, or 250 million … Read more
